2009 Yecla, Spain Tempranillo
The Terrenal Parcelas Terrenal Tempranillo from the captivating Yecla region of Spain is a remarkable expression of the Tempranillo varietal. This vintage, dating back to two thousand nine, showcases a beautiful red hue that entices the eye. The wine presents a medium-bodied profile with a delightful balance of acidity, offering a refreshing lift that enhances its overall elegance. Rich and prominent fruit intensity dominates the palate, with notes of ripe cherries and plums, complemented by subtle earthy undertones. Tannins are firm yet well-integrated, providing structure without overwhelming the fruit. This red wine is wonderfully dry, making it an excellent choice for pairing with grilled meats or hearty stews, ensuring every sip is a delectable experience that reflects the unique terroir of Yecla.
